Barrie is a pleasant small city (135,000) situated on Lake Simcoe and within a two hour's drive of downtown Toronto. Many commute to Toronto by train each day. I think it's an attractive place with good summer and winter activities. It has expanded greatly in the past few years to become a Toronto bedroom community but there is so much farmland between the Toronto outskirts and Barrie, that it certainly retains its distinctiveness. It's touted as a good place to live and is surrounded by great recreational land, forests, lakes etc.

We have a house in Barrie although we still live in England. We use the house ourselves for a couple of months a year and rent it out the rest of the time.
We absolutely love the place, the people are really friendly and we have some really good friends out there. There are quite a few Brits in town already so its not unusual to hear an English accent.

We have two teenage kids and there is loads to do for us all, its great having white Christmas' and be able to ski (although not very well yet) in the winter and then spend warm summers out there by the lake.
